A guitar string is clamped at both ends and is under a certain tension as it lies horizontally (along the x - axis, say). When p

lucked, the vibrating string is found to have a harmonic at a frequency of 560 Hz. When plucked another way, the vibrating string is observed to have a harmonic at a frequency of 700 Hz. You are told these harmonics are consecutive modes of oscillation. The velocity of the travelling waves is 200 m/s. Determine the length of the string.

Answer:

The length of the string is \frac17 m.

Explanation:

Data provided in the question:    

Velocity, V = 200 m/s      

Initial frequency \Rightarrow  f_1=550 \ Hz,

Final frequency, \quad f _{2}=700\ Hz

Now, we know      

\Rightarrow \lambda=\frac Vf\\ \Rightarrow \lambda_{1}=\frac{v}{f_1}\\ =\frac{200}{560}=\frac{2}{5 .6}=\frac {2.5}7

and,        

\qquad \lambda_{2}=\frac V {f_2}=\frac{200}{700}=\frac{2}{7}\text { Here } \lambda_{1}=2 \lambda+\frac \lambda {2}=\frac{5 \lambda}{2}=2.5 \lambda            

also,

\lambda=l=\frac{2.5}7\times\frac 1 {2.5}=\frac{1}{7}          

Therefore,        

The length of the string is \frac17 m.

You slide a breakfast plate along the counter toward your friend, but your friend misses it and the plate slides off the edge of
andrezito [222]

Answer: 0.27 m

Explanation:

The plate slides off the counter with the speed , u = 0.61 m/s in the horizontal direction.

The height of the counter is, y = 0.93 m

The initial speed in the vertical direction is 0 m/s. The plate falls under gravity in the vertical direction.

The time taken for plate to reach the surface is:

y = 0.5 gt²

⇒ t = √0.93 m / √4.9 m/s² = 0.44 s

In the same time, the plate would cover horizontal distance of:

x = u t = 0.61 m/s × 0.44 s = 0.27 m

Thus, the plate falls 0.27 m away from the base of the counter.
